2DTIC ADA170303: Queueing Analysis Of Fault-Tolerant Computer Systems.

By

This paper analyzes a fault-tolerant computer system. The failure/repair behavior of the system is modeled by an irreducible continuous-time Markov chain. Jobs arrive in a Poisson fashion to the system and are serviced according to an FCFS discipline. A failure may cause the loss of the work already done on the job in service, if any; in this case the interrupted job is repeated as soon as the system is ready to deliver service. In addition to the delays due to failures and repairs, jobs suffer delays due to queueing. The authors presents a queueing analysis of fault-tolerant systems and study the steady-state behavior of the number of jobs in the system. As a numerical example, they consider a system with two processors subject to failures and repairs. (Author)

3Transient Analysis Of A Resource-limited Recovery Policy For Epidemics: A Retrial Queueing Approach

By

Knowledge on the dynamics of standard epidemic models and their variants over complex networks has been well-established primarily in the stationary regime, with relatively little light shed on their transient behavior. In this paper, we analyze the transient characteristics of the classical susceptible-infected (SI) process with a recovery policy modeled as a state-dependent retrial queueing system in which arriving infected nodes, upon finding all the limited number of recovery units busy, join a virtual buffer and try persistently for service in order to regain susceptibility. In particular, we formulate the stochastic SI epidemic model with added retrial phenomenon as a finite continuous-time Markov chain (CTMC) and derive the Laplace transforms of the underlying transient state probability distributions and corresponding moments for a closed population of size $N$ driven by homogeneous and heterogeneous contacts. Our numerical results reveal the strong influence of infection heterogeneity and retrial frequency on the transient behavior of the model for various performance measures.

4Queueing Analysis In Multiuser Multi-Packet Transmission Systems Using Spatial Multiplexing

By

Multiuser Multi-Packet Transmission (MPT) from an Access Point (AP) equipped with multiple antennas to multiple single antenna nodes can be achieved by exploiting the spatial dimension of the channel. In this paper we present a queueing model to analytically study such systems from the link-layer perspective, in presence of random packet arrivals and heterogeneous channel conditions. The analysis relies on a blind estimation of the number of different destinations among the packets waiting in the queue, which allows for building a simple, but general model for MPT systems. Simulation results validate the accuracy of the analytical model and provide further insights on the cross-relations between the channel state, the number of antennas, and the number of active users, as well as how they affect the system performance. The simplicity and accuracy of the model makes it suitable for the evaluation of link-layer protocols supporting multiuser MPT in non-saturation conditions, where the queueing dynamics play an important role on the achieved performance.

6Queueing Theoretical Analysis Of Foreign Currency Exchange Rates

By

We propose a useful approach for investigating the statistical properties of foreign currency exchange rates. Our approach is based on queueing theory, particularly, the so-called renewal-reward theorem. For the first passage processes of the Sony Bank US dollar/Japanese yen (USD/JPY) exchange rate, we evaluate the average waiting time which is defined as the average time that customers have to wait between any instant when they want to observe the rate (e.g. when they log in to their computer systems) and the next rate change. We find that the assumption of exponential distribution for the first-passage process should be rejected and that a Weibull distribution seems more suitable for explaining the stochastic process of the Sony Bank rate. Our approach also enables us to evaluate the expected reward for customers, i.e. one can predict how long customers must wait and how much reward they will obtain by the next price change after they log in to their computer systems. We check the validity of our prediction by comparing it with empirical data analysis.

7DTIC ADA361701: Analysis Of A Non-Trivial Queueing Network

By

In studying complex queueing networks, one generally seeks to employ exact analytic solutions to reduce burden on computational resources. Barring the existence of an exact solution, the alternatives include approximation techniques and simulation. Approximation is the more attractive alternative from a time and effort perspective; however, cases exist that are not amiable to this technique. This work increases the flexibility of approximation techniques in obtaining estimates of congestion measures for complex, open queueing networks having several customer classes and class-dependent structures. We accomplish this by providing the procedure to aggregate multiple classes into a single class in order to apply an existing approximation technique. The resulting method is shown to yield good agreement with results obtained by simulation. The immediate application of this work is as a tool to focus a simulation study of multi-class queueing networks. For large networks, reasonable performance estimates can be obtained quickly. Once the basic input parameters are determined, different scenarios may be rapidly evaluated in a fraction of the time needed to modify a typical simulation model. This allows one to check ideas and determine where to invest time and funding when constructing a simulation model to obtain performance estimates on a by-class basis.

10A Section-Based Queueing-Theoretical Traffic Model For Congestion And Travel Time Analysis In Networks

By

While many classical traffic models treat the spatial extension of streets continuously or by discretization into cells of a certain length, we will subdivide roads into comparatively long homogeneous road sections of constant capacity with an inhomogeneity at the end. The related model is simple and numerically efficient. It is inspired by models of dynamic queueing networks and takes into account essential features of traffic flows. Instead of treating single vehicles or velocity profiles, it focusses on flows at specific cross sections and average travel times of vehicles.

14DTIC ADA1029929: Queueing Network Analysis In Software Physics,

By

Queueing network models have achieved a prominent place in the modelling of computer system performance. Recent formulations of operational methods by Buzen and others have greatly facilitated their practical use. On the other hand, Kolence's software physics has addressed the problem of appropriate metrics for both performance and capacity of processors and systems and for the workloads with which they interact. This paper integrates the methods of operational queueing network analysis into an extension of software physics. A significant feature of this approach is that parameters of the equipment and of the workload are not confounded in the analysis but are kept distinct, finally combining in the model computations proper. The objectives, principles and assumptions are stated and the basic quantities are defined. The fundamental operational laws and certain of the algorithms are derived and illustrated with examples. 15DTIC ADA141175: B-1B Avionics/Automatic Test Equipment: Maintenance Queueing Analysis.

By

The purpose of this research effort was to develop a technique to determine B-1B automatic test equipment station quantities required to support the B-1B avionics components at base level. As part of this effort, both simulation and analytical solutions were developed. A detailed and complex simulation model was developed in the Q-GERT simulation language. In addition, an analytical model was developed based on the theory of open queueing networks and other queueing techniques. However, the analytical model required many crude and simplifying assumptions, and the analytical results were not entirely satisfactory. The Q-GERT simulation model was selected as the best choice for the remainder of the research effort. Two techniques were developed to determine test station quantities based on the model output. The first technique was to buy sufficient test stations to achieve a four day maximum base repair cycle time for the avionics components. The second technique was to conduct a cost-benefit analysis by comparing the costs of additional test stations (and the benefits of shorter repair cycle times) to the benefits of fewer test stations (and the costs of longer repair cycle times). Considerable sensitivity analysis was performed with the simulation model, and the research effort concludes with a range of management options for consideration by the B-1B System Program Office. 16Dynamical Analysis Of The Exclusive Queueing Process

By

In a recent study [C Arita and D Yanagisawa: J. Stat. Phys. 141, 829 (2010)] the stationary state of a parallel-update TASEP with varying system length, which can be regarded as a queueing process with excluded-volume effect (exclusive queueing process, EQP), was obtained. We analyze the dynamical properties of the number of particles $ < N_t>$ and the position of the last particle (the system length) $ < L_t>$, using an analytical method (generating function technique) as well as a phenomenological description based on domain wall dynamics and Monte Carlo simulations. The system exhibits two phases corresponding to linear convergence or divergence of $ < N_t>$ and $ < L_t>$. These phases can both further be subdivided into high-density and maximal-current subphases. The predictions of the domain wall theory are found to be in very good agreement quantitively with results from Monte Carlo simulations in the convergent phase. On the other hand, in the divergent phase, only the prediction for $ < N_t>$ agrees with simulations.

20Analysis Of The Optimal Resource Allocation For A Tandem Queueing System

By

In this paper, we study a controllable tandem queueing system consisting of two nodes and a controller, in which customers arrive according to a Poisson process and must receive service at both nodes before leaving the system. A decision maker dynamically allocates the number of service resource to each node facility according to the number of customers in each node. In the model, the objective is to minimize the long-run average costs. We cast these problems as Markov decision problems by dynamic programming approach and derive the monotonicity of the optimal allocation policy and the relationship between the two nodes' optimal policy. Furthermore, we get the conditions under which the optimal policy is unique and has the bang-bang control policy property.

30DTIC ADA242364: Delay Analysis For Multidimensional Queueing Process In CSMA/CD Local Area Networks

By

A CSMA/CD local area network consists of single server (the channel) and multiple interacting queues of message packets. The message queueing process in a buffered, P-persistent CSMA/CD system is modeled as a multidimensional semi-markov chain. An effective approximation method to compute the mean packet delay in equilibrium is developed, based on the joint probability generating function of the queue length vector at embedded Markov epochs. We also develop a simulation model to validate approximation results. To the best of our knowledge, this work is the first in the literature that enables optimization of the control parameter P for the CSMA/CD system with more than two users. (Author)

31Queueing Analysis Of A Large-Scale Bike Sharing System Through Mean-Field Theory

By

The bike sharing systems are fast increasing as a public transport mode in urban short trips, and have been developed in many major cities around the world. A major challenge in the study of bike sharing systems is that large-scale and complex queueing networks have to be applied through multi-dimensional Markov processes, while their discussion always suffers a common difficulty: State space explosion. For this reason, this paper provides a mean-field computational method to study such a large-scale bike sharing steps: Firstly, a multi-dimensional Markov process is set up for expressing the states of the bike sharing system, and the empirical process of the multi-dimensional Markov process is given to partly overcome the difficulty of state space explosion. Based on this, the mean-field equations are derived by means of a virtual time-inhomogeneous M(t)/M(t)/1/K queue whose arrival and service rates are determined by the mean-field computation. Secondly, the martingale limit is employed to investigate the limiting behavior of the empirical process, the fixed point is proved to be unique so that it can be computed by means of a nonlinear birth-death process, the asymptotic independence of this system is discussed simply, and specifically, these lead to numerical computation of the steady-state probability of the problematic (empty or full) stations. Finally, some numerical examples are given for valuable observation on how the steady-state probability of the problematic stations depends on some crucial parameters of the bike sharing system.

39NASA Technical Reports Server (NTRS) 19820009378: Queueing Analysis Of Synchronous Time Division Multiplexing With Individual Source Buffering

By

Synchronous time division multiplexing is analyzed. Packets of information arrive at the system as a compound Poisson process, and are transmitted only during individual periodic intervals. Packet arrivals are blocked (lost) if the system has a finite capacity and is congested. Using the theory of semiregenerative processes, the distribution of the number of packets in the system (system size) is found. This nonstationary distribution is used to determine the complete system behavior, including the delay distributions, the blocking probability, and the density of the system size at arrival instants. Numerical examples illustrate applications of the results given.

42Statistical Analysis Of Single-server Loss Queueing Systems

By

In this article statistical bounds for certain output characteristics of the $M/GI/1/n$ and $GI/M/1/n$ loss queueing systems are derived on the basis of large samples of an input characteristic of these systems, such as service time in the $M/GI/1/n$ queueing system or interarrival time in the $GI/M/1/n$ queueing system. The analysis of this article is based on application of Kolmogorov's statistics for empirical probability distribution functions.

44Random Linear Network Coding For Time-Division Duplexing: Queueing Analysis

By

We study the performance of random linear network coding for time division duplexing channels with Poisson arrivals. We model the system as a bulk-service queue with variable bulk size. A full characterization for random linear network coding is provided for time division duplexing channels [1] by means of the moment generating function. We present numerical results for the mean number of packets in the queue and consider the effect of the range of allowable bulk sizes. We show that there exists an optimal choice of this range that minimizes the mean number of data packets in the queue.

45DTIC ADA444295: Information Theoretic Analysis For A General Queueing System At Equilibrium With Application To Queues In Tandem

By

In this paper, information theoretic inference methodology for system modeling is applied to estimate the probability distribution for the number of customers in a general, single server queueing system with infinite capacity utilized by an infinite customer population. Limited to knowledge of only the mean number of customers and system equilibrium, entropy maximization is used to obtain an approximation for the number of customers in the G{G}1 queue. This maximum entropy approximation is exact for the case of G=M i.e., the M{M}1 queue. Subject to both independent and dependent information, an estimate for the joint customer distribution for queueing systems in tandem is presented. Based on the simulation of two queues in tandem, numerical comparisons of the joint maximum entropy distribution is given. These results serve to establish the validity of the inference technique and as an introduction to information theoretic approximation to queueing networks.

47A Transient Queueing Analysis Under Time-varying Arrival And Service Rates For Enabling Low-Latency Services

By

Understanding the detailed queueing behavior of a networking session is critical in enabling low-latency services over the Internet. Especially when the packet arrival and service rates at the queue of a link vary over time and moreover when the session is short-lived, analyzing the corresponding queue behavior as a function of time, which involves a transient analysis, becomes extremely challenging. In this paper, we propose and develop a new analytical framework that anatomizes the transient queue behavior under time-varying arrival and service rates even under unstable conditions. Our framework is capable of answering key questions in designing low-latency services such as the time-dependent probability distribution of the queue length; the instantaneous or time-averaged violation probability that the queue length exceeds a certain threshold; and the fraction of time during an interval $[0, t]$ at which the queue length exceeds a certain threshold. We validate our framework by comparing its prediction results over time with the statistical simulation results and confirm that our analysis is accurate enough. Our extensive demonstrations on the efficacy of the analytical framework in designing low-latency services reveal that its prediction ability for the transient queue behavior in diverse time-varying packet arrival and service patterns can be of a high practical value.

49DTIC ADA033290: Analysis And Simplifications Of Discrete Event Systems And Jackson Queueing Networks.

By

This dissertation contians studies in two related areas: Discrete Event Systems Theory and Queueing Network Theory. In the first line of study, deterministic discrete event systems are modeled by formal automata- like structures, and a hierarchy of morphic relations among them is developed. A canonical representation of stochastic discrete event systems in coordinate probability space is proposed, and a hierarchy of morphic relations among them is constructed by means of measure preserving transformations. In the second line of study, several operating characteristics of the class of Jackson queueing networks are investiaged. Included are: line sizes (network state), total service awarded to customers, and traffic processes on the arcs. Special emphasis is placed on rigorous derivations of results from solid mathematical and statistical foundations. In the process, a number of theoretical gaps in the extant theory of state equilibrium are closed, and Burke's Theorem is extended from M/M/1 queues to Jackson networks with single server nodes.
